Toward the end of the book, Misha, Janina, and the boys are in the ghetto and night after night they escape the ghetto in search of food. For some reason, Misha doesn't run away. He keeps going back to the ghetto, feeding the orphans and Janina's family. Janina's sick mom eventually ends up dying. Misha, Janina and the father go to the cemetery to bury her, but while they're there the Russians start to bomb the town. To stay safe, they hop into the hole dug for Janina's mom and it protects them from the bombs. Back in the ghetto after the bombing, the Jackboots are starting to crack down on any Jew that they find smuggling. That puts Misha and Janina's life at risk because every night they smuggle. Week after week, Misha starts to find bodies all over the ghetto. But these bodies aren't just random bodies. They are his friends. Misha and Janina's friends are starting to get caught and killed.
